Kadai Paneer ( Rotis and Subzis) recipe with step by step photos
Fresh dry masala powder recipe for Kadai Paneer- The real flavour in this recipe comes from the freshly ground red chillies and whole coriander. So first take whole dry Kashmiri red chillies in a non-stick pan.
- Add coriander seeds and roast on a non-stick tava (griddle), for a few seconds.
- Cool and grind in a mixer to a fine powder. I would suggest you to make this powder and store for other uses like sprinkling on dhoklas, dosas, salads etc. or adding to potato subzi or any dry subzi. It lends an awesome taste.
Kadai Paneer Gravy Recipe- First heat oil in a non-stick pan. Add chopped garlic.
- To this add the prepared dry masala powder.
- Then add the chopped green chillies.
- Add the finely chopped tomatoes and cook on a medium flame.
- Mix well and cook for 10 to 12 minutes till soft and cooked or else there will be a raw taste and will not taste good. Mash it with a potato masher or with the back of a spoon for a nice thick pulp.
- Add tomato puree.
- Add some water and salt to taste.
- Crush the dry fenugreek leaves between your palms and add to the gravy.
- Add garam masala.
- Let the gravy simmer till the oil separates, while stirring occasionally.
- First lightly fry the paneer cubes in hot oil till light brown. Do this so that the paneer does not break when added to the gravy. As far as possible use fresh soft paneer. To make paneer at home follow our recipe for Homemade paneer. Also, don’t discard the whey when you make the paneer and use it for making whey soup.
- Put the fried paneer in luke warm water, they will become soft.
Kadai Paneer Recipe- Heat oil in a kadai. Add finely chopped onions.Sauté the onions till they turn translucent.
- Add the prepared kadai gravy. Mix well.
- Add coriander-cumin seeds powder.
- Then add chilli powder and turmeric powder.
- Add garam masala.
- Then add dried fenugreek leaves.
- Add 1 cup water.
- Add sliced capsicum and salt to taste.
- Drain and add the paneer cubes.
- Add fresh cream and mix well. Remove in a plate and serve with rotis, paratha or naan.
